The most racially diverse public elementary schools in Kent County, Rhode Island

25 public elementary schools in Kent County, Rhode Island appear in this ranking of the most racially diverse public elementary schools, ranked by how small the single largest racial or ethnic group is, so no one group dominates. Oakland Beach School leads the list at 55.2%, against a median of 70.0% across the ranked schools.
